Unboxing and Initial Setup

Every Trezor device comes carefully packaged with tamper-evident security features. Follow these steps to ensure a safe start:

Step 1: Inspect Your Device

Check that the package is sealed and the holographic sticker is intact. Learn more at Trezor official guide.

Step 2: Connect the Device

Use the provided USB cable to connect your Trezor device to your computer. Trezor will power up automatically.

Step 3: Visit Trezor Start Page

Open your browser and navigate to https://trezor.io/start for instructions tailored to your specific model.

Step 4: Install Trezor Bridge or Suite

Trezor Bridge or Suite ensures seamless communication between your device and computer. Download it from the official site.

Creating a New Wallet

Once your device is connected, creating a new wallet is straightforward. Follow the steps below for a secure setup:

Step 1: Choose “Create New Wallet”

On the Trezor interface, select “Create New Wallet”. This ensures a fresh start without importing old keys.

Step 2: Backup Your Recovery Seed

Trezor generates a 12- or 24-word recovery phrase. Write it down and store it in a safe place. Never store it digitally. Learn more at Trezor's official instructions.

Step 3: Confirm Recovery Seed

Your device will ask you to confirm your recovery seed to ensure it was correctly noted.

Step 4: Set Up a PIN

Choose a secure PIN. This adds an extra layer of protection. Always follow best practices for PIN security as described on Trezor Start.

Security Best Practices

Keep Your Recovery Seed Safe

Your recovery seed is the key to your funds. Never store it digitally or share it with anyone. For detailed guidance, visit Trezor Start.

Update Firmware Regularly

Regular firmware updates patch vulnerabilities. Check your device regularly via Trezor Suite or Trezor official page.

Beware of Phishing

Always verify website URLs and never click suspicious links. Use official Trezor links for safety.
